St. Louis’s City Foundry needs a coffee place. Got a decent mocha from the waffle joint but could not track down plain old coffee.

The strongest coffee this side of Cafe du Monde may be at Half and Half in Clayton. It’s good but damn strong.

Best restaurant coffee enjoyed lately was at Kingside in the CWE and Annie Gunn’s in Chesterfield Valley. Both serve Dubuque Coffee which is not from Iowa but from Brentwood.

It seems less tacky for Starbucks to raise prices than for them to increase the number of stars required for rewards. Although raising prices as often as they do is a bit tacky.

Starbucks CEO Howard Schultz prefers his coffee black says a WSJ article about black coffee fans having long waits for their basic brew while baristas fill complex drink orders at Starbucks and Dunkin’.

Two of the best cups of coffee I’ve had in recent times were enjoyed last September and December in Milwaukee’s Historic Third Ward from the walk-up window at Onesto restaurant. (They just closed the walk-up window which they said was a pandemic thing.)

Although we have some excellent roasters here in town, I have been ordering dark roast whole beans lately from Vermont Artisan coffee. Quality products and quick order fulfillment.
